Theres a notice that recommends fish intake for the Yarra, Maribrynong rivers -4liters wrote:I'll give it a go one day, maybe after I've had kids though...
Adults eat no more than once a week, children once a month, pregnant women not to consume any fish or eels.

Re: Yarra Bream
Possible - been a few footballs around lately... Last year spawning was closer to November but it's not exactly clockwork. They're definitely in pre-spawn condition. I'd expect they're in the process of heading upstream to the spawning grounds but some aggregations may spawn earlier (or later). If you think they've moved on worth checking further up the system this time of year. Big flushes of fresh will push them down the system (especially in the yarra since its a salt wedge estuary and the bream will relate to the seaward edge of the wedge) but in general the drive around this time should be to head up system ready to spawn.
But then again they're bream and when you think you have them figured they prove you wrong again
